Just an FYI, Vitamin K actually assists with blood clotting, it is not a blood thinner. It is used to reverse the effects of coumadin (a blood thinner). We give it to our surgery patients sometimes to help reverse the effects of their blood thinners in order for them to have unplanned surgery. That is why patients on coumadin are warned not to consume large amounts of greens because the vitamin k in the greens can interfere with the action of the blood thinner.
